WebAssisted decision-making. The South African Law Reform Commission is engaged in an investigation into the law with regard to assisted decision-making, with a view to its reform. Making decisions is an important part of human life. Although we take it for granted that adults can make decisions about their personal welfare, financial affairs and ... WebDementia in South Africa Whilst dementia is a growing worldwide challenge, affecting all races, genders and socio-economic groups, South Africa with its growing elderly population, poor socio-economic conditions and highest global HIV/AIDS infection rate is especially vulnerable. WebMar 25, 2024 · Key Points. Question Is multidimensional poverty associated with dementia in older adults in low- and middle-income countries?. Findings In this cross-sectional study of 227 adults aged 50 years or older living in Soweto, Johannesburg, South Africa, 20% of adults with dementia were poor compared with 10% of those without dementia, with a …
